Have you ever encountered the error code 4742 on your tractor?

This code, also known as “ALL Left Swash Plate Angle Sensor Pin A Shorted To Power Amber,” indicates a problem with the left swash plate angle sensor pin A.

When this error occurs, you may experience issues with the tractor’s hydraulic system. The most common cause of this error is a short circuit in the sensor pin A, which leads to it being constantly powered.

  • To fix error code 4742, which indicates that the Left Swash Plate Angle Sensor Pin A is shorted to power and displays an amber warning, follow these steps: 1.
  • Begin by disconnecting the tractor’s power source to ensure safety.
  • 2.
  • Locate the Left Swash Plate Angle Sensor Pin A and inspect it for any visible damage or loose connections.
  • 3.
  • If there are no visible issues, use a multimeter to test the sensor’s continuity and resistance.
  • 4.
  • If the sensor fails the continuity and resistance tests, it will need to be replaced with a new one.
  • 5.
  • Install the new Left Swash Plate Angle Sensor Pin A and ensure it is securely connected.
  • 6.
  • Reconnect the tractor’s power source and start the engine to check if the error code has been resolved.
  • 7.
  • Monitor the tractor’s performance and verify that the left swash plate angle readings are normal, the hydraulic system operates consistently, and the power output is restored.
  • 8.
  • Test the tractor’s movements to ensure that control is no longer difficult.
  • 9.
  • If the error code persists or the symptoms continue, it is recommended to consult a professional technician for further assistance.
  • By following these steps, you can effectively address error code 4742 and restore optimal functionality to your tractor.
